Nothing to come of it

I’m being tail gated. I can see that in my rear view mirror. What do they want? Did I do something to anger them? Why won’t they go away?

Turns out they have. Turns out the went down the last turn off. No more tailgating.

Getting all worked up about a tailgater only to then realise it was not even an issue. It may not be what you wanted to happen, you probably wanted nothing to happen, but at least nothing did happen, right?
